(a) Apakah maksud kadar tindak balas?
What is meant by rate of reaction?
Perubahan kuantiti bahan tindak balas per unit masa atau perubahan hasil tindak balas per unit masa.
The changes in the quantity of the reactants per unit time or the changes in the quantity of the products per unit time.

(c) Nyatakan perubahan pada kuantiti bahan tindak balas dan kuantiti hasil tindak balas semasa tindak balas
berlaku.
State the changes of the quantity of reactants and quantity of products during the reaction.
• Kuantiti bahan tindak balas berkurang. / Quantity of reactants reduces.
• Kuantiti hasil tiindak balas bertambah. / Quantity of products increases.
